About This Item
New York: Ecco Press, 1984. Stated First edition. Hardcover. Very good +/fine. 8vo. Quarter black cloth and red boards, with red spine lettering. 101 pages. Faint spotting to top text block, else Fine. No names, remainder marks, or marks to text. In illustrated dust-jacket (with price intact).
